更新时间:2022-12-14 GMT+08:00
基于用户和角色的鉴权
该任务指导系统管理员在Manager创建并设置FlinkServer的角色。FlinkServer角色可设置FlinkServer管理员权限以及应用的编辑和查看权限。
用户需要在FlinkServer中对指定的用户设置权限,才能够更新数据、查询数据和删除数据等。
前提条件
集群管理员已根据业务需要规划权限。
操作步骤
- 登录Manager。
- 选择“系统 > 权限 > 角色”。
- 单击“添加角色”,然后在“角色名称”和“描述”输入角色名字与描述。
- 设置角色“配置资源权限”。
FlinkServer权限类型:
- FlinkServer管理员权限:是最高权限,具有FlinkServer所有应用的业务操作权限。
- FlinkServer应用权限:可设置对应用的“应用查看”、“应用编辑”权限。
表1 设置角色 任务场景
角色授权操作
设置FlinkServer管理员权限
在“配置资源权限”的表格中选择“待操作集群的名称 > Flink”,勾选“FlinkServer管理操作权限”。
设置用户对应用的指定权限
- 在“配置资源权限”的表格中选择“待操作集群的名称 > Flink > FlinkServer应用权限”。
- 在“权限”列,勾选“应用查看”或“应用编辑”。
- 单击“确定”完成,返回角色管理。
FlinkServer角色创建成功后,可创建一个FlinkServer用户并绑定角色和用户组。
父主题: FlinkServer权限管理